CMapStringToOb::Lookup

BOOL Поиска ( LPCTSTR ключ, CObject * & rValue ) const;

Возвращаемое значение

Ненулевое значение, если элемент найден; в противном случае 0.

Параметры

ключ

Задает строковый ключ, который идентифицирует элемент выполняться поиск.

rValue

Указывает возвращаемое значение из элемента посмотрел вверх.

Примечания

Поиск использует алгоритм хэширования для быстрого поиска карты элемент с ключом, который соответствует именно (CString значение).

Пример

Смотрите CObList::CObList список CAge класс, используемая во всех примерах коллекции.

/ / Пример для CMapStringToOb::LookUp

CMapStringToOb карта;
Кейдж * ПА;

карта.Set&At ("Bart", новый Кейдж (13));
карта.SetAt ("Лиза", новый Кейдж (11));
карта.SetAt ("Гомера", новый Кейдж (36));
карта.SetAt ("Мардж", новый Кейдж (35));
ASSERT (карта.Поиск ("Лиза", (CObject * amp;) ПА)); / / «Лиза» на карте?
ASSERT (* ПА == Кейдж (11)); / / Это она 11

Обзор CMapStringToOb |nbsp; Члены класса | Иерархическая схема

См. также [CMapStringToOb::operator]

Index